2023年业绩点评:2023年业绩高于预期,期待2024年盈利表现
Investment Rating - The report maintains a "Buy" rating for Anta Sports, indicating a positive outlook for the company's stock performance relative to the market [4][11]. Core Insights - The Chinese sports industry is entering a new phase characterized by stable overall growth and structural differentiation, with Anta Sports positioned as a rare multi-brand leader that aligns with new development trends [3]. - The company achieved a revenue of 62.36 billion RMB in 2023, reflecting a year-on-year growth of 16.2%, while net profit attributable to shareholders reached 10.24 billion RMB, up 34.9% year-on-year [3]. - For the years 2024 to 2026, the projected net profits are 13.26 billion RMB, 14.07 billion RMB, and 16.08 billion RMB respectively, with corresponding price-to-earnings ratios of 16, 15, and 13 times [3]. Financial Summary - In 2023, the company's revenue was 62.36 billion RMB, with a gross profit margin improvement driven by a higher proportion of direct-to-consumer (DTC) sales [3][7]. - The main brand's gross margin increased by 1.3 percentage points, while Fila's gross margin improved by 2.6 percentage points due to better discount management [3]. - The company anticipates steady revenue growth in 2024, with guidance for the main brand and Fila at 10-15%, Descente at over 20%, and Kolon at over 30% [3].

业绩表现超预期,24年安踏、FILA指引双位数增长
申万宏源· 2024-03-27 16:00
Investment Rating - The report maintains a "Buy" rating for Anta Sports [2] Core Views - Anta Sports reported a strong performance in 2023, with revenue increasing by 16% to 62.36 billion RMB and net profit rising by 35% to 10.236 billion RMB, exceeding expectations [2][6] - The company aims for double-digit growth in 2024 for both Anta and FILA brands, supported by effective brand management and operational improvements [2] - The successful IPO of Amer Sports is expected to contribute positively to Anta's performance in 2024, with a projected one-time gain of approximately 1.6 billion RMB [2] Financial Performance Summary - In 2023, Anta's revenue reached 62.36 billion RMB, with a year-on-year growth rate of 16% [2][9] - The net profit for 2023 was 10.236 billion RMB, reflecting a 35% increase compared to the previous year [2][9] - The gross margin improved by 2.4 percentage points to 62.6%, while the net profit margin increased by 2.3 percentage points to 16.4% [2][6] - The company plans to achieve revenues of 70.32 billion RMB in 2024, with a projected growth rate of 13% [9] Brand Performance - Anta brand revenue grew by 9.3% to 30.306 billion RMB in 2023, with a gross margin of 54.9% [2] - FILA brand revenue increased by 16.6% to 25.103 billion RMB, with a gross margin of 69.0% [2] - Other brands saw a significant revenue increase of 57.7% to 6.947 billion RMB, benefiting from outdoor trends and high brand recognition [2] Store Expansion and Channel Strategy - Anta's adult stores increased by 129 to 7,053 in 2023, with expectations to reach 7,100-7,200 stores in 2024 [2] - FILA's store count decreased by 12 to 1,972, but is expected to recover in 2024 with an increase to 2,100-2,200 stores [2] - The company is optimizing its new brand stores while expanding its main brand presence [2] Profitability and Efficiency - The company achieved a significant improvement in profitability, with operating profit margin rising by 3.7 percentage points to 24.6% [2] - Inventory turnover days decreased by 15 days to 123 days, indicating improved efficiency [2] - Operating cash flow increased by 62% year-on-year to 19.634 billion RMB [2]

2023年业绩超预期,各品牌经营利润率均实现提升
Shanxi Securities· 2024-03-27 16:00
Investment Rating - The report maintains a "Buy-A" rating for Anta Sports (02020 HK) [2] Core Views - Anta Sports' 2023 performance exceeded expectations with significant growth in revenue and net profit [2][3] - The company's offline channels outperformed e-commerce, with a 16 2% YoY increase in revenue to RMB 62 356 billion and a 34 9% YoY increase in net profit to RMB 10 236 billion [1][3] - All brands achieved improved operating profit margins, with FILA brand reaching a historical high of 27 6% [2][4] Revenue Breakdown - Anta brand revenue grew 9 3% YoY to RMB 30 306 billion, accounting for 48 6% of group revenue [1] - FILA brand revenue increased 16 6% YoY to RMB 25 103 billion, representing 40 3% of group revenue [4] - Other brands revenue surged 57 7% YoY to RMB 6 947 billion, contributing 11 1% to group revenue [5] Channel Performance - DTC channel revenue for Anta brand grew 24 2% YoY to RMB 17 005 billion, accounting for 56 1% of Anta brand revenue [1] - E-commerce revenue increased 11 0% YoY but its share of group revenue declined by 1 5 percentage points to 32 8% [1] - Traditional wholesale and other channels revenue decreased 22 7% YoY to RMB 3 370 billion [1] Profitability - Gross margin improved by 2 4 percentage points to 62 6% in 2023, driven by Anta's DTC transformation and FILA's retail discount improvement [5] - Operating cash flow surged 61 6% YoY to RMB 19 634 billion [5] - Inventory turnover days decreased by 15 days to 123 days, with inventory declining 15 1% YoY to RMB 7 210 billion [5] Store Expansion - Anta brand stores increased by 129 to 7,053, while Anta Kids stores grew by 99 to 2,778 by end of 2023 [1] - FILA brand stores decreased by 12 to 1,972, with plans to expand to 2,100-2,200 stores by end of 2024 [4] - Descente and Kolon Sport stores are expected to reach 220-230 and 180-190 respectively by end of 2024 [5] Future Outlook - Anta brand and FILA brand are expected to achieve 10%-15% retail sales growth in 2024 [6] - Descente brand is projected to grow retail sales by at least 20%, while Kolon Sport is expected to grow by at least 30% in 2024 [6] - The company anticipates recording a one-time gain of RMB 1 6 billion in H1 2024 due to Amer Sports' IPO [5]
